Janice Jacobs, a retired resident of Sacramento, CA, shares her passion for spreading positivity. With a message filled with optimism, she reminds readers to stay present and mindful, highlighting the positive impact it can have on our overall well-being.
Janice’s wisdom serves as a gentle reminder to find joy in the simplest moments and appreciate the alignment of circumstances that can lead to personal growth and fulfillment. This book is a must-read for anyone seeking a boost of positivity and a reminder to embrace gratitude in their everyday life.

Janice Jacobs took me on a captivating journey of “ah ha moments” and manifestation in her book, “I Said What I Said, and the Universe Provided.” With a blend of captivating personal stories and personal experiences, the individual contributors outline the power and beauty of manifestation, emphasizing the influence of words and thoughts in shaping one’s own reality.
Each chapter I found myself needing and wanting more. The writing is both relatable and empowering, making it accessible to readers at various points in their manifestation journey.
Jacobs encourages introspection and offers actionable steps to harness the energy of the universe for positive transformation. Jacobs’ unique perspective makes this a compelling read for those seeking real-life transformation and believe, blessings do exist in all areas of our lives.

I am retired. I have always been fascinated and inspired by stories from other people about how they were able to manifest something in their lives. I have many stories myself about how things seem to have miraculously come together for me. I wanted to share these stories with the world; hopefully, to inspire others. I have one daughter and I've tried to teach her how to notice how everything can work together for her good if she stays mindful and is grateful for even the smallest of things.
